原文:析 合 樹 詳 解

由於快考試了先咕掉 在閱讀本文之前,請保證先讀過OI WIKI上的文章 沒讀過也沒關系,因為接下來我會先復讀 基本定義 首先明確一下連續段的含義,連續段其實就是某一個子段,它的數值經過sort之后是連續的一段,比如 , , , 等等,析合樹就是由部分連續段組成的樹,注意是部分,而不是所有,因為某些特殊數據可以使得連續段達到 n 個,直接建樹會炸。 於是就要抽出一些更有代表性的連續段,稱這些段為本原 ...

2020-08-04 07:46 10 238 推薦指數:

查看詳情

啃WC課件系列。 LCA講得很好了(雖然一些奇怪的定義讓人摸不着頭腦),為了以后復習方便自己再整理下。 是用於連續段問題的比較通用的數據結構。 首先定義一下連續段:對於一個長度為\(n\)的排列\(p\),如果對於一個區間\([l,r]\),如果\(p_l,p_{l+1},\dots ...

Fri Feb 22 04:54:00 CST 2019 1 1740
【學習筆記】

定義 為了方便,下面的定義都是對一個\(n\)階排列 定義一個段的值域$ran[l,r] = [min \ a_i \ , \ max \ a_i] (l \le i \le r) $ , ...

Fri Jun 14 15:23:00 CST 2019 1 1215
設備

一. DTS 語法 1.1. dts 頭文件 1.1.1. 可以使用#include來引用 1.2. 關於/dts-v1/; 1.2. ...

Thu Apr 02 08:09:00 CST 2020 0 600
STM8S103內存

STM8S103的RAM有1k,0x00-0x3FF(RAM和ROM統一編址),其中0x200-0x3ff共512個字節默認為堆棧,剩余的低端512個字節又分為了Zero Page和剩余的RAM(簡稱 ...

Fri Mar 10 05:27:00 CST 2017 0 1516
匯編中retn 4的含義

retn 4 是個函數返回指令。 以前一直糾結這個retn的寄存器操作順序,手頭正好在調試,詳細跟了一下,豁然開朗,特分享。先假設個環境:retn 4未執行時,ESP=0013feb8;EIP=5 ...

Fri Aug 29 21:25:00 CST 2014 0 5107
MySQL索引失效的幾種情況

1.前導模糊查詢不能利用索引(like '%XX'或者like '%XX%') 假如有這樣一列code的值為'AAA','AAB','BAA','BAB' ,如果where code like '% ...

Fri Jan 08 04:56:00 CST 2021 0 587
javaclass和public class區別

public class和class的區別 類的定義有兩種方式: public class 類名 class 類名 我可以將class前面的public去掉,如果采用publi ...

Sun Jul 15 07:08:00 CST 2018 0 1404
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M